The EDU-C9800-L-C-K9 is a Cisco-certified training and lab access bundle focused on mastering the Catalyst 9800 Series Wireless LAN Controllers. Designed for network engineers and IT teams, this kit combines Cisco’s official e-learning modules, virtual lab environments, and performance validation tools to bridge the gap between theoretical knowledge and hands-on implementation. Unlike generic certifications, it targets enterprise-scale wireless deployments, including SD-Access, IoT integration, and AI-driven network analytics.
According to Cisco’s 2023 training report, engineers completing this program demonstrate a 50% faster resolution time for WLC-related outages compared to non-certified peers.
